The paper "Art Analysis" tells us about Lane with Poplar Trees" by Van Gogh.... This is one of Van Gogh's earliest landscapes.... He painted it in October of 1884 while staying with his parents at Nuenen in the Netherlands....

It is also a part of the Chinese customs to serve Chinese dates, peanuts, longan and chestnuts as a way of wishing the couple to have baby soon.... When a family member is about to travel to far away places, it is part of the Chinese tradition to serve dumplings as a sign of farewell.... (Travel China Guide, 2007b; Chan, 2004) Other important Chinese feast and Festivals within the Chinese culture includes the Chinese New Year's Eve wherein people serve fish as a sign of prosperity and wealth; moon festival wherein moon cakes are distributed to relatives and friends as part of the celebration (Russell, 1997); and the Hungry Ghost Festival where they serve some food offerings to their dead relatives and family members (Vethanayagam, 2002; Teiser, 1996)....
